    I post on eight different sites...One has been hit hard with **** in the past week.

    I doubt there is any sort of world wide conspiracy going on…Just random luck.

    Couple of the sites I post on have good rules and such in place via options built into vBulletin…Any member with less then 10 posts AND have a url in their post get filtered and a mod must approve the posts before the public can view them.
